Social media is abuzz with controversy after reports emerged of a young woman being detained by Nigerian Police in Anambra State allegedly for the unusual offense of appearing in public without wearing a bra.
The incident gained traction following a viral post on X (formerly Twitter) claiming the arrest was connected to rumors of a government directive specifically targeting women who venture outside their homes without wearing bras.
Adding fuel to the growing online debate is circulating video footage showing a visibly distressed woman in a dress seated in the back of a police vehicle.
The clip also appears to show officers actively patrolling the area, reportedly searching for other women violating this alleged dress code restriction.
